The exceptional services of Île-de-France prefectures
The prefectures of Île-de-France assist people with many services. This includes online procedures, in-person meetings, and many others. They also have offices that deal with the economy, employment, and the environment.
Since 2004, prefects have had specific roles. They organize themselves to better assist the region. In 2010, changes made services more convenient.
After the Ancien Régime, Paris, Seine-et-Oise, and Seine-et-Marne became departments. There were 83 departments in total. Later, in the 1980s, the government granted more powers to locally elected places.
Nearly 19% of the French population lives in Île-de-France. They share only 2% of all of France. The region has 11,000 employees to assist people. They have a budget of 2.5 billion euros.
Thanks to these prefectures, the region manages policies and crises. Their work is very important.

Simplified administrative procedures in Île-de-France
In Île-de-France, administrative procedures are becoming simpler thanks to the prefectures. They offer online services and easier processes. The goal is to improve access to public services and better coordinate the actions of the region.
The prefects of the region play a significant role. They ensure that administrative practices are aligned. Thus, services improve for cities and citizens.
A decree from 2004 changed the work of prefects and state services. The aim is to be more efficient and closer to the people. This reform helps modernize the state, provide better services while reducing taxes.
